Output 8d277fc79bba147326c4d7a09f4da78b76512b85831a633896a7b1edbfadddaa:1

value
376656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81730560c4326e7a675b64a694fa87f63f7357da OP_EQUAL
address
3DVUt69gcUWukUeSCQgWCMTEG5DWBBV8Gg
transaction
8d277fc79bba147326c4d7a09f4da78b76512b85831a633896a7b1edbfadddaa
confirmations
238707
spent
true